Barça gained momentum this Sunday before the national team break. The azulgranas beat Osasuna in a match in which they went from more to less and in which they did not resolve the ballot until the final moments, thanks to a penalty from Lewandowski. With this victory, in which the two Joaos made their debut, the Catalans add three consecutive victories and follow in the wake of a Real Madrid that remains intractable in the lead.

With the knife between his teeth. This is how Barça came out to fight in a Sadar packed to the brim. The Osasuna fiefdom did not disappoint despite the downturn of falling in the Conference League on Thursday and generated an atmosphere of those that make your hair stand on end. That environment did not weigh on them, yes, some culés who started the clash with the clear intention of being protagonists from the first minute. Xavi, who did not initially give Joao Cancelo and Joao Félix the alternative, doubled the bet for the 4-4-2 with Oriol Romeu and Frenkie de Jong seated in the double pivot, with Sergi Roberto in the right-hand lane and with Lamine Yamal alongside Lewandowski for the third consecutive match.

The bet was clear and known. Barça pressed in the opposite field, took control of the midfield thanks to that extra midfielder and began to widen the field of play with continuous incursions from the wingers. Thus he managed to bottle up Jagoba Arrasate’s men, who introduced up to nine changes compared to the duel played in Bruges, and thus forged an unsuccessful trickle of chances. De Jong smashed a ball into the woodwork, Lewandowski finished off wide in the small area and Gündogan missed a rebound that was free to open the scoring.

It was a promising start for the azulgranas that very soon was going to be slowed down by the momentum of Osasuna. The locals raised the intensity, advanced ranks and found talented players like Aimar Oroz or Rubén García in intermediate positions, to the point of even threatening Ter Stegen who had to intervene twice. A new afternoon of shocks for the German goalkeeper was already ruminating when Koundé flew more than anyone in a corner kick and headed into the net to thwart Osasuna’s rebellion before the break.

After the restart, Barça tried to cool the spirits of a Sadar who was clamoring to equalize the contest. The culés lowered the ball to the grass, arranged long circulations of the ball and anesthetized the local push after passing through the changing rooms. It was a moment of tranquility for Xavi, who knew that Osasuna’s final rush was missing. He brought in Cancelo and Ferran Torres to refresh the team, but it wasn’t enough to counter the masterstroke Arrasate had in store. The coach from Biscay went to plan B and introduced Barja, Chimy Ávila and Budimir in one fell swoop to turn the pitch onto Ter Stegen’s goal.

The game changed completely. The newcomers modified the energy of the clash and began a carousel of balls to the area that found a prize with a superb kick from Chimy Ávila from the front against which Ter Stegen could do nothing. Sadar came to a boil, they wanted more, and Xavi looked for offensive solutions with the entry of Joao Félix, who made his debut without much noise in the middle of the storm. Barça forgot about the break, became a participant in Osasuna’s vertigo and in a ball rained into the Lewandowski area, unprecedented until then, he was brought down by Catena as the last man. The play was oil and ended with a penalty, a red card for the defender and a goal from eleven meters from the Pole to avoid the mess in the final stretch and send the Catalans to a break with a new and long-suffering victory.
